I've noticed a bit of a discrepancy on *A Partner earnings. Perhaps all is fine, but it seems like UA is giving out more MP miles (redeemable, not PQM) for partner flights than their mileage charts indicated.
Recent example on Air Canada. Booked BOS-YYZ-FRA in D (Business Class Fare) ticketed on Air Canada 014 Ticket stock. The "Earning Miles" chart for Air Canada located at https://www.united.com/ual/en/us/fly...ir-canada.html indicates for a D fare I should earn 200% of flown mileage as redeemable Mileage Plus miles. It says this 200% is "including fare class bonus." PQM chart also indicates I should earn 200% of flown miles as premier qualifying. So, based on the cart, I would expect PQM and redeemable miles to be the same for this trip. When flights posted, PQM miles were as expected (200%), but redeemable award miles were 50% more than expected. Here are the details: BOS-YYZ in D (business class) -PQM Earned: 1000 (this is correct and as expected) -MP Miles Earned: -Base MIles: 446 (actual miles flown, which is less than 500 miles) -Bonus Miles: 892 (200% of "base miles") -Total Miles earned: 1338 miles. But according to UA Website it should only be 892 (200% of "base miles"). YYZ-FRA in D (business Class) -PQM Earned: 7876 (200% of flown. This is correct) -MP Miles Earned: -Base MIles: 3938 - Bonus Miles: 7876 (200% of base miles) -Total MIles earned: 11,814 (Except UA websites indicates this should be 7876...200% of base miles.) I've noticed this same calculation on Lufthansa and other partners too. So...why do you think we are earning more than what the website publishes? Is the website earnings chart incorrect, or is UA IT incorrectly calculating. For these flights I would have expected redeemable miles to = PQM earned since both indicate 200% bonus. But it seems we actually earn 50% more redeemable than what the website says because "Bonus MIles" is being calculated at the % indicated on the website, and then this is being added to "base miles." |
